Taxonomic Classification

Rank Alpine Pika Schneeglöckchen
Kingdom Animalia (Tier) Plantae (Pflanzen)
Phylum Chordata (Chordatiere)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Säugetiere) Liliopsida (Monocots)
Order Lagomorpha (Hasenartige) Asparagales (Spargelartige)
Family Ochotonidae Amaryllidaceae
Genus Ochotona Galanthus
Species Ochotona alpina Galanthus nivalis
